Who We Are
Del Property Management (DPM) is a trusted leader in residential condominium property management with over 56 years of experience. We manage over 87,000 condominium homes across 300 communities in the Greater Toronto Area (GTA). Recognized as the #3 condominium manager in Canada by the REMI Network, we pride ourselves on our commitment to excellence and integrity in all aspects of our business.
Position Summary
The Operations Administrator plays a critical role in supporting the company's day-to-day operational and administrative functions. This position is responsible for coordinating relief staffing, maintaining site communications, supporting compliance and licensing activities, managing operational reporting, and ensuring the accuracy of business records across multiple systems.
Working closely with Operations, People & Culture, Finance, and Business Development teams, the Operations Administrator helps drive operational excellence through effective coordination, administration, communication, and process support. The ideal candidate is highly organized, detail-oriented, service-focused, and capable of managing competing priorities in a fast-paced environment.
